  • Spiritual growth requires more than good intentions. It requires training.

    https://patrickryanlewis.com/2026/08/19/train-yourself-for-godliness-the-discipline-of-a-life-devoted-to-christ/

    In 1 Timothy 4:7–8, Paul tells Timothy:

    “Instead, train yourself for godliness.”

    Just as physical strength is developed through consistency, spiritual maturity grows as we intentionally spend time in God’s Word, pray, worship, serve, repent, and obey.

    The question isn’t simply, “Do I want to grow closer to God?”

    The deeper question is:

    What am I doing consistently that is training me to become more like Jesus?

    Our newest blog looks at Paul’s challenge to reject distractions, develop spiritual discipline, and invest our lives in something that has value not only for today—but for eternity.

    Read: “Train Yourself for Godliness: The Discipline of a Life Devoted to Christ”

    Don’t underestimate ordinary obedience practiced consistently.

    Read the Word. Pray. Worship. Serve. Repent. Reflect. Obey. Keep showing up.

  • 1 John 1:9 If we confess our sins, he is faithful and just and will forgive us our sins and purify us from all unrighteousness. 

    In today’s verse there is no mention of repentance or repenting but the core message is based upon that action. If we are to confess our sins and be purified, we must first turn from the wrongful behavior and seek Him and His ways. Then we have the promise that He is just and will forgive us.

    The Apostle John wrote his letter to believers who were facing false teachers. These false teachers claimed they were sin free. But we know from Paul that no one is sin free for ALL have sinned and fall short of the glory of God (Romans 3:23). We inherited our sinful nature from Adam and Eve and no matter how hard we try we will never be totally sin free. 

    Lucky for us, God loves us despite that. He provided a way to escape the punishment of sin and the consequences that our actions would result in. He gave His Son, perfect and blameless, the only one to ever be sin free, as a sacrifice for our sin. He died on the cross and was raised again to satisfy the requirement of the law for the remission of sin. And we are made righteous because of Him.

    This verse is not about salvation though. It is about restoring fellowship with God. If we claim we have fellowship with Him but are living a life of hidden sin or denying our sinful nature then that fellowship is disrupted. Instead, we are walking in darkness and lying against the truth (1 John 1:6; 1 John 1:8). 

    The only way for us to restore fellowship with Him is to repent and turn back to Him once more. We must confess our sins in order to be forgiven. The Greek word for confess is homologeo and literally means to say the same thing or to agree with God about our sin. We don’t make excuses or try to hide it, instead, seeking His ways and His will for our lives. 

    And when we repent and change our behavior, He forgives us. He gives us grace and mercy that we don’t deserve. The penalty for our sin is paid in full thanks to the death of Jesus on the cross. When we acknowledge our sin and ask for forgiveness, the barrier that prevented us from fellowship with Him is removed and we have our relationship restored. 

    Don’t let your sin come between you and God. Confess, repent, and seek Him once more. He is waiting and faithful, ready to embrace you just like the father of the prodigal son did. He will restore fellowship with you and you will be made righteous and holy. But it all begins with repentance. What are you waiting for?
